Alisson's dramatic late header away at West Brom kept Liverpool in the race for top four - which could be decided by the tightest of margins. Jurgen Klopp 's former champions were in desperate need of three points at the Hawthorns on Sunday, but Hal Robson-Kanu's early goal left them trailing. Mohamed Salah then equalised just after the half-hour mark, before Alisson headed home the most astonishing of stoppage-time winners right at the death - becoming only the sixth goalkeeper to score in the Premier League. His goal means Liverpool are now only one point adrift of fourth-place Chelsea and three behind Leicester in third, and the latter pair are due to play each other on Tuesday. The Reds' two remaining fixtures come away at Burnley on Wednesday and at home to Crystal Palace next Sunday, while Leicester and Chelsea have tough outings against Tottenham and Aston Villa respectively after their meeting on Tuesday. North West 200: Business owners lap up rise in trade

May 14, 2022 by www.bbc.co.uk

By Mike McBride & Will Burton Published 2 days ago Share close Share page Copy link About sharing The North West 200 has finally revved back into action on the Triangle circuit. After a three-year absence due to the Covid-19 pandemic, the world famous road race has been even more keenly anticipated than usual. But it is not just road racing fans who are thrilled to see riders back. Many businesses in Portstewart, Portrush and Coleraine will hear the welcome sound of cash registers over revs of motorbike engines. David Boyd, president of Causeway Chamber of Commerce, said it had been a long time, but he was thrilled to see one of Northern Ireland's showpiece sporting events back once again. From despair to delight in nine years for Swansea City

May 27, 2011 by www.bbc.co.uk

By David Dulin Published 27 May 2011 Share close Share page Copy link About sharing Swansea City stand on the brink of promotion to the Premier League - dubbed the world's richest league - yet nine years ago, they were on the verge of going bust. Businessman Tony Petty's turbulent three-month spell in charge at the end of 2001 almost brought the club to its knees. Supporters took to the streets in protest against the Australian's running of the club as he attempted to sack seven players and two coaches, which the Professional Footballers' Association thwarted. But a local consortium of supporters, headed by former director Mel Nurse, later battled to gain control of the club. And on 24 January, 2002 - reportedly 24 hours before the club was set to go out of business - they ousted Petty.
